Web7 apr. 2024 · If you have questions about information that appears on Maryland's Charity Database or wish to report suspicious fundraising activity, you can contact the Charitable Organizations Division, Office of the Secretary of State, 16 Francis Street, Annapolis, Maryland 21401, 410-974-5521 / 800-825-4510. WebGuideStar works to improve public access to information about nonprofit organizations by providing Forms 990 and other data through their searchable online database.
